Exceptional and provisional habilitation for people who work or have worked in professional categories of caregiver, geriatrician, home help assistant and personal assistant, in centers or social services in the field of care of people in a situation of dependency, and who do not have official accreditation of the professional qualification through the corresponding academic degree or certificate of professionalism.

Requirements
- Requirements
For exceptional habilitation:
a) Possess Spanish nationality, have obtained the certificate of registration of Community citizenship or the family card of a citizen of the European Union, or be the holder of a valid residence or residence and work permit in Spain, under the terms established in the Spanish regulations on foreigners and immigration.
b) That the last company where they provided their services is located in the Autonomous Community of Cantabria.
c) Prove that on 31 December 2017 they had at least three years' work experience, with a minimum of 2,000 hours worked, in the last 12 years in the professional category in which they are applying for the exceptional habilitation, or without reaching the minimum required experience, they had worked and have a minimum of 300 hours of training related to the experience with the competencies professionals from among the following: Caregiver, Geriatrician, Home Help Assistant, Personal Assistant.
d) Not having official accreditation for the exercise of the profession, through the qualifications or certifications detailed in Order UMA/17/2018, of 24 April, or their equivalents for employment purposes.For provisional habilitation:
a) Those established in letters a), b) and d) above.
b) To have worked prior to 31 December 2017 in the aforementioned professional categories, without reaching the periods of experience or training established in letter c) above.
c) To commit, by means of a responsible declaration, to participate in processes of evaluation and accreditation of said work experience, or to carry out related training.
In the event of not participating in the processes of evaluation and accreditation of the experience, or not carrying out the related training, the provisional habilitation will cease to have effects.

Required documentation
Documentation accrediting work experience. - Certification from the General Treasury of the Social Security, the Social Institute of the Navy or the mutual society to which they were affiliated, stating the company, the job category (contribution group) and the period of employment (Working life). - Employment contract or certification from the company where they have acquired the work experience, which specifically states the duration of the periods of provision of the contract, the activity carried out and the time interval in which said activity has been carried out.
